Abstract
The present invention relates generally to the communication of vehicle data, diagnostics and related information with a network remote from the vehicle, and more particularly to communications and storage of vehicle data in the cloud. In one or more preferred embodiments, vehicle information is securely gathered from a vehicle, processed in accordance with instructions and a profile set remotely, and stored at a remote data store, where remote access to such information can be accommodated through applications, smartphones and other remote devices.

18. An apparatus for communicating and storing vehicle information from a vehicle across a remote network to one or more remote devices utilizing at least one communication protocol of the vehicle, comprising:
-
a device protocol system capable of communications with a remote service broker system and a vehicle, the device protocol system having; a protocol adapter for communicating with a vehicle communication system of the vehicle across one or more defined protocols and receiving vehicle data, and a device controller for communicating received vehicle data and one or more network storage addresses with a service broker system across the remote network, the service broker system having; a broker network module for receiving and sending one or more messages with one or more of the device controller, a device maker, a vehicle manufacturer, a vehicle assignee, a data store, and a mobile application;
a decoder for decoding received vehicle data from the device protocol system; andan access control module for providing a data use profile rule set for the vehicle data; an access control module, wherein the access control module includes a data sharing profile which includes identifiable attributes, authentication and authorization rules and duration, to an entity in control of the vehicle to allow for control of how data of the vehicle will be shared; and a communications module for transmitting at least one message having a device ID, and the received vehicle data, from the device protocol system across the remote network to a service broker system capable of mapping the device ID to a network ID; wherein the device ID is decoupled from the network ID providing service portability and mobility, and whereby the service broker system stores decoded vehicle data to the one or more remote devices across the remote network in relation to the one or more remote network storage addresses. - View Dependent Claims (19, 20)
